Coleraine Bowling Club opens its green for 2014 season

Coleraine Bowling Club hosted their annual ‘Opening of the Green’ on Friday 4th April, with a large number of members, family, friends, sponsors and dignitaries gathered at Lodge Road to open the 2014 season.

Honorary Secretary Jordan Dallas welcomed everyone to the club before going on to mention that 2013 had been a special year for the club with the Senior team bringing back the Irish Senior Cup to Coleraine for the first time in 92 years and for the second time in their history following the thrilling victory over Ballymoney back in August at Belmont BC.

Jordan went on to say that he wished all the teams similar success this incoming season and hopefully the club could add to their haul of 63 trophies, adding that a lot of hard work had went on during the off season to further the facilities at Lodge Road before thanking the sponsors for their continued support.

The secretary then introduced President Basil Kennedy’s partner, Jean who threw the silver jack and first bowl to officially open the green for the new season before the incoming Vice-President, Jordan Dallas presented Jean with a bunch of flowers on behalf of the club.

Lady President Rosemary Lyons officially opened the green for the Ladies Club before outgoing President, Nora Lafferty presented Rosemary with a gift on behalf of Coleraine Ladies.

President Basil then unfurled the club flag to complete the opening ceremony before the members and guests retired to the clubhouse for the speeches and meal.

President Basil, Lady President Rosemary, Deputy Mayor Mark Fielding and NIPBA Vice-President Noel Linton all spoke and wished the club all the best for the new season with Mark and Noel congratulating the club, once again, on the historic Irish Cup victory and bringing great honour to the town.

Thanks must go to Jean, Rosemary and the rest of the Coleraine Ladies who prepared and served a lovely meal to complete another great evening at Lodge Road.

A raffle was held in aid of the ‘Help Wee Oliver Walk’ appeal, with the club raising £217 and our thanks must go to all who contributed. Coleraine members are reminded that the panel meetings are this Monday, the 14th April, starting at 7pm with the Senior team.
